Bishop's Manor is a 5-story apartment building/condominium for low income people located at 200 Nina Gardens NE, Calgary, AB. It was built in 2021, and the system is undoubtedly original.

System Specifications (2021-present)[edit | edit source]

FACP[edit | edit source]

The building is protected by a Mircom FX-2000 addressable fire alarm system. The panel is located in the main entrance vestibule. The system runs Mircom's Advanced addressable protocol, and the system coding is temporal.

Notification Appliances[edit | edit source]

All common areas have System Sensor "L-Series" P2RLA horn/strobes (red, wall-mount, bilingual, set to 15cd/electromechanical).

All units have Mircom MH-S25WA silenceable mini-horns (white, wall-mount), as well as System Sensor SRLA remote strobes (red, wall-mount).

For outdoor notification, there is a System Sensor "SpectrAlert Advance" SRKA weatherproof remote strobe (red, wall-mount) outside the main entrance.

Initiating Devices[edit | edit source]

Pull Stations[edit | edit source]

All pull stations are Mircom MS-401AP addressable single-action pull stations.

Modules[edit | edit source]

There are Mircom MIX-M500MAPA addressable monitor modules supervising the sprinkler system's tamper and flow switches.

EOLs[edit | edit source]

There are Mircom MP-300 end of line resistor plates on all sprinkler and signal circuits.
